The MBTI system classifies individuals into 16 distinct personality types based on four fundamental dimensions: Introversion vs. Extroversion, Sensing vs. Intuition, Thinking vs. Feeling, and Judging vs. Perceiving. Each type exhibits a unique combination of these traits, resulting in a diverse range of perspectives, motivations, and communication styles.

The Myers-Briggs Type Indicator (MBTI) presents a popular personality assessment tool that categorizes individuals into 16 distinct personality types. Each type indicates a unique combination of preferences in four dimensions: introversion vs. extroversion, sensing vs. intuition, thinking vs. feeling, and judging vs. perceiving.
